Chapter 2 Preparations
7. Put the additional CPU on the CPU socket slowly and gently.
For easy installation, hold edges of CPU with your thumb and index fingers so that the notch is aligned
with the key on the CPU socket.
8. Lightly push the CPU to the CPU socket, and close the plate.
9. Close the socket lever marked with "←
50
Important
• Be sure to hold the CPU only at the edges.
• Pay attention not to touch the bottom of the CPU (pin section).
Note
• Insert the CPU while aligning the notch on the CPU with the key on the CPU
socket.
• Bring down the CPU straight without tilting or sliding it in the socket.
